 ===== Validation ===== ===== Validation =====
  
-Given a PML file, how do I validate it? I always forget... Please provide me with the one-liner to do the validation.+Given a PML file, how do I validate it?
  
 +For most purposes, a libxml2 (DOM) based validator
 +<code>/f/common/exec/validate_pml --pml-dir /f/common/share/pml --path /f/common/share/tred file_to_validate</code>should work fine and fast.
  
 +For huge files, use<code>/f/common/exec/validate_pml_stream --path /f/common/share/tred file_to_validate</code>which is based on Jing (SAX); Jing has no Zlib or stdin support, so some space in /tmp will be needed for temporary files.
 +Both scripts have decent user documentation. See inside the scripts if interested in the implementation details.
  
 ===== XSH Won't Work: Blame XML Namespaces ===== ===== XSH Won't Work: Blame XML Namespaces =====
Line 39: Line 45:
 The reason why ''cd tdata'' won't work is a badly specified XML namespace. This works: The reason why ''cd tdata'' won't work is a badly specified XML namespace. This works:
  
-<code>$f/>regns pml http://ufal.mff.cuni.cz/pdt/pml/+<code>$f/>regns pml http://ufal.mff.cuni.cz/pdt/pml/;
 $f/>cd pml:tdata $f/>cd pml:tdata
 $f/pml:tdata> $f/pml:tdata>
 </code> </code>
 +
 +Hint: add the regns command to your ~/.xsh2rc.
  
 You will have to write the ''pml:'' prefix before every tag name in every XPath! You will have to write the ''pml:'' prefix before every tag name in every XPath!
  
-Most probably you'll still face problems when accessing attributes of XML elements, because namespacing rules apply differently to attributes and elements. I hate XML and will never stop hating it! +Most probably you'll still face problems when accessing attributes of XML elements, because namespacing rules apply differently to attributes and elements. You'll need to read XML (Namespaces) specification.
